Market Response to Geopolitical Stability

Bitcoin experienced a significant rally late Tuesday, pushing its market value beyond the $72,500 threshold. The digital asset climbed roughly 5% in a matter of hours, reaching a peak of $72,753. This sudden upward movement coincided with diplomatic developments involving the United States and Iran.

Market sentiment shifted rapidly after President Donald Trump indicated a strategic pause in hostilities. The announcement of a ceasefire effectively lowered geopolitical anxiety, which had previously weighed on global financial markets. Investors reacted to the news by moving capital back into risk-on assets, with Bitcoin serving as a primary beneficiary of the improved outlook.

The cryptocurrency sector often reacts sharply to international conflicts, as traders seek safety during periods of uncertainty. When tensions between major powers escalate, Bitcoin frequently faces downward pressure alongside traditional stock indices. Conversely, the promise of a peaceful resolution serves as a catalyst for renewed buying interest.

Trading volume surged as the price broke through key resistance levels. Analysts observed that the market was primed for a rebound once the threat of immediate military escalation subsided. The rapid recovery underscores the sensitivity of digital currencies to high-level diplomatic rhetoric and global security updates.

Strategic Outlook for Digital Asset Holders

Institutional and retail participants alike capitalized on the favorable news cycle to bolster their positions. The 5% gain represents one of the most decisive moves for the asset in recent days. By stabilizing above the $72,000 mark, Bitcoin has reclaimed a technical position that many traders view as a foundation for further growth.

Market participants are now closely monitoring whether this momentum can be sustained throughout the week. While the ceasefire provides a necessary reprieve, the long-term trajectory of Bitcoin remains tethered to broader macroeconomic conditions. Investors are weighing the impact of reduced geopolitical risk against ongoing monetary policy shifts.

The current price action suggests that the crypto market is becoming increasingly responsive to external political events. As the situation in the Middle East stabilizes, observers expect volatility to decrease, potentially allowing for a more predictable trading environment. Traders are advised to remain cautious, as global relations can shift without warning.

Looking ahead, the focus will likely turn toward sustained price consolidation. If the ceasefire holds, the market may see a period of accumulation. However, any return to instability could quickly reverse the recent gains. For now, the crypto community is viewing the latest developments as a positive signal for the near-term financial landscape.
